Index: content/renderer/render_frame_impl.cc |
diff --git a/content/renderer/render_frame_impl.cc b/content/renderer/render_frame_impl.cc |
index 0179a9c1a5568f865c138447966a8f0d0b83418a..d1c5da6018df1df2fa69e92ac0a6002150f6e3ba 100644 |
--- a/content/renderer/render_frame_impl.cc |
+++ b/content/renderer/render_frame_impl.cc |
@@ -2866,6 +2866,9 @@ blink::WebMediaPlayer* RenderFrameImpl::createMediaPlayer( |
#if BUILDFLAG(ENABLE_MEDIA_REMOTING) |
remoting_controller_ptr->SetSwitchRendererCallback(base::Bind( |
&media::WebMediaPlayerImpl::ScheduleRestart, media_player->AsWeakPtr())); |
+ remoting_controller_ptr->SetRemoteSinkAvailableChangedCallback(base::Bind( |
+ &media::WebMediaPlayerImpl::ActivateViewportIntersectionMonitoring, |
+ media_player->AsWeakPtr())); |
#endif |
return media_player; |
} |